What is the Rubiks Game?
The Rubiks Game, also known as the Rubiks Cube, is a 3D mechanical puzzle that was invented in 1974 by Hungarian architect Ernő Rubik. It consists of a small cube made up of smaller, individual cubes that can be twisted and turned to mix up the colors. The objective is to return the cube to its original state, where each face has one color.

Tips for Solving the Rubiks Game
Start with the Cross: Begin by solving the cross on the bottom face of the cube. This is a fundamental step and will help you develop a pattern recognition skill.
Learn Notations: Familiarize yourself with the notations used to describe the movements of the cubes pieces. This will make it easier to understand and follow various solving methods.
Practice Regularly: Like any skill, solving the Rubiks Cube requires practice. Try to solve the cube multiple times a day to improve your speed and accuracy.
